Understanding Hurricane-Resistant Windows for Florida Homes
Living in Florida means embracing the sunshine, but also dealing with the possible threat of hurricanes. Protecting your residence from damaging winds and airborne debris is essential , and hurricane-resistant panes play a vital role. These aren’t just ordinary windows; they are built to withstand intense winds and impact . There are several types available, including impact-resistant glass laminated between layers of strong material, and those fortified with protective films. Consider aspects like the this impact rating, design pressure, and manufacturer's reputation when making your choice . Proper installation is also utterly required to ensure optimal performance. Windows vs. Impact Windows: What's the Difference?
Choosing the right glass type for your property can be difficult, especially when you encounter terms like "windows" and "impact windows." Generally, "windows" refers to typical panes designed for ventilation and light. These are often made of one layer of glass and provide basic protection. In opposition, "impact windows" – also known as hurricane windows – are a distinct option engineered to withstand severe storms , including high winds, flying debris, and projectile hits . They feature a enhanced construction, typically utilizing laminated glass and reinforced frames, making them significantly more resilient than traditional openings .
- Standard Windows: Provide ventilation and light.
- Impact Windows: Withstand severe weather and impacts.
- Construction: Standard windows have a simpler design; impact windows are built with reinforced materials.
